Marketing On Social Media Platforms

Social media marketing is among the most widely used and successful methods of promoting a product on the web.

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, Pinterest, and LinkedIn are examples of social media sites that your prospective customers frequent. Your target audience will determine which platforms are ideal for you. What websites do they frequent the most? Your attendance is mandatory. If your social media posts don’t reflect your brand voice, your consumers won’t be able to tell the difference.

Keep your audience interested and engaged by posting engaging information. You may customize the experiences of your Facebook, Tiktok, or Instagram followers by responding to their comments and messages. This feedback will establish you as a user-friendly brand which will in turn help you grow your organic following and exposure to your products.

People wearing your items or gushing about your goods might be shared as user-generated content. When your fans post about you, encourage them to use your brand’s hashtag to make it easy for you and others to locate this material.

Do not forget to include a link to your online shop, where you may advertise your most recent, best-selling, and soon-to-be-released items.

Content Marketing

Create and distribute material such as podcasts and quizzes in order to build a relationship with your target audience via content marketing. If you want to get people interested in you and your goods, this isn’t the best way to go about it. As a long-term approach, content marketing pays off. Why is this so?

It’s a great way to cultivate consumer relationships and keep them around. As a result, you may position yourself as an expert in your field and a reliable resource for others. Traditional marketing costs 62% more than content marketing, yet generates three times as many leads.

For content marketing leaders, annual traffic increase is approximately eight times greater. In order to generate trust and interest in your brand, you need to create useful content that appeals to your target audience. Your material might also become viral, which is a bonus.

Optimization For Search Engines

Search engine optimization is an integral part of any digital marketing plan. It isn’t the most unique or most entertaining way to sell your business, but it’s an effective way to get more visitors to your website from search engines. Selling online needs a high volume of high-quality site visitors.

Although the optimization process in itself might seem confusing, the key is to understand the language your clients use when doing online research. What are the most likely search phrases they’ll use to find similar items?

Do they have any concerns or issues that your goods can address? Create a list of keywords, and then incorporate those keywords into the pages and content of your site.

Sponsorships For Events

Getting your online store’s name out there by sponsoring a local event is a brilliant idea. A link to your website and other promotional materials and social media postings may be included on the event page.

The promoters of the event should include flyers or pamphlets with your URL in any handouts or goodie bags. When a booth chance arises, take advantage of it. Encourage people to visit your website by handing out flyers or little gifts that include an invitation to visit it, and make use of the chance to meet new people.
